Chrystell

A variant of Chrystel or Chrystal with doubled 'l', emphasizing a more ornate, elaborate aesthetic. This spelling emerged from contemporary creative naming trends favoring extra letters for visual distinction. It has a slightly fanciful, individualized quality.
